Strangely enough, a lot of horrible loose players will fold their mid-pairs when it comes one more back to them on the turn, even when it may even be correct for them to draw because of the pot size and the situation. It's one of the few situations where these people have an opportunity to make "smart" laydowns, and it makes them feel good inside methinks.
The exception is when they are royally stuck.
